Check out the LimeSurvey source code on GitHub!

Prefilling Answers not working

More
3 years 1 month ago #102681 by wiz561
Hi!

I have a survey setup where there's a "short free text" question that is the "Project Title". The "Project Title" is passed through the URL into the survey with the format:

http://<url>/limesurvey/index.php?sid=43221&lang=en&token=<token>&43221X4X23=<project title>

This is working fine and as expected. I have another survey that I copied from the above one into a new survey. The new survey URL is...

http://<url>/limesurvey/index.php?sid=637774&lang=en&token=<token>&637774X32X805=<project title>

The problem is that passing the information in the URL doesn't work for this second one. I've tried a number of URL combinations, added 'newtest=y' as a variable into the URL, but nothing seems to work.

I'm running Limesurvey 2.00+ Build 131206 on Ubuntu Linux and nginx. Any ideas on why this isn't working would be great.

Thanks!

Please Log in to join the conversation.

More
3 years 1 month ago #102695 by tpartner
That's weird - all I can think of is that one of the IDs is incorrect.

Cheers,
Tony Partner

Solutions, code and workarounds presented in these forums are given without any warranty, implied or otherwise.

Please Log in to join the conversation.

More
3 years 4 weeks ago #102879 by wiz561
I know, tell me about it! I triple checked all the SID's and the other numbers, and they are all correct.

The only thing I can think of is that the web server may not be passing the information across properly. I'm using nginx with the php-fpm. The nginx logs show the URL properly (along with what's being passed), but I'm wondering if something else isn't working...but then that doesn't explain why one survey works and the other doesn't.

What a mystery...

Thanks!

Please Log in to join the conversation.

Imprint                   Privacy policy         General Terms & Conditions         Revocation information and revocation form